On full lock to the right 80% of the time it will do this:

20140831_195448_Android.jpg


It won't do it when I'm turning left. It's rubbing the shock. Does anyone know why exactly? :bang:

Standard seicento wheels. The only thing thats changed on the car is the 60mm lowering, is that causing it?
 
It will be spaced out 10mm soon enough but for the moment I'm wondering what's actually causing it as it wasn't doing it before and it's on standard parts?

There's basically no camber on it at all and as mentioned above surely there should be no change in the distance between the wheel and shock as the hub is fixed?

There is plenty of knocking from that corner so I think I will have it apart and stick a different top mount on at the weekend. Even if that doesn't change it at least I will know everything is done up tight.

Edit: I may get a 32mm? socket and check the hub nut is tight as well...
 
Last edited:
Well I actually had the wheel off today for a proper look and it's not the shock!

Despite being amazingly close it's not touching it, it's rubbing the lower ARB bracket so it's down to the lowering!

I'll be careful with it for now and spacing it out will fix it :)
